Catégories
- Actualité du Web (4)
- Axestech.net (4)
- Clients (1)
- Git (1)
- Hadopi (1)
- MySQL (1)
- Non classé (1)
- Pauz'Kfé (2)
- Pear (1)
- Recrutement (1)
- Réseaux sociaux (1)
- Symfony (4)
- Tutoriaux (6)
Liens
Qu’est-ce que le fichier .gitignore ?
Ce fichier, présent à la racine de votre projet Git, permet de contrôler automatiquement les mises à jour Git que vous aller effectuer (envoi/réception… git push/git pull) en précisant les fichiers ou répertoires qui ne doivent pas être indexés.
Mon .gitignore ne fonctionne pas !
Dans certain cas, il est possible que votre fichier .gitignore ne fonctionne pas, notamment si ce dernier n’a pas été initialiser lors de la création de la première branche Git.
Pour régler ce problème, il faut nettoyer le cache du Git, en exécutant les commandes suivantes :
Attention : Pensez à faire une sauvegarde de votre projet Git en local.
Supprimer la mise en cache :
git rm -r --cached .
Mise à jour :
git add .
Commit :
git commit -m "Le .gitignore est maintenant fonctionnel"
Pour ceux qui débutent avec le Git, voici un exemple de fichier .gitignore :
cache/* log/* web/uploads/* config/databases.yml config/propel.ini data/sql lib/filter/doctrine/base/Base* lib/form/doctrine/base/Base* lib/model/doctrine/base/Base* lib/model/om/* lib/model/map/*
Vous devez être connecté pour rédiger un commentaire.